E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
java架构设计原则
Unity实现GoF23种设计模式
:二、结构型模式(StructuralPatterns):三、行为型模式(BehavioralPatterns):Unity实现GoF23种设计模式概要GoF所提出的23种设计模式主要基于以下面向对象
设计原则
Cxihu树北
·
2023-12-16 09:13
设计模式
游戏引擎
unity3d
设计模式之建造者模式(二)
目录概述概念角色类图适用场景详述画小人业务类的介绍代码解析建造者基本代码类介绍代码解析总结
设计原则
其他概述概念 建造者模式是一种创建型设计模式,它可以将复杂对象的构建过程与其表示分离,使得同样的构建过程可以创建不同的表示
赛男丨木子丿小喵
·
2023-12-16 09:07
设计模式
设计模式
建造者模式
容器中的JVM资源该如何被安全的限制?
欢迎工作一到五年的Java工程师朋友们加入
Java架构
开发:277763288群内提供免费的
Java架构
学习资料(里面有高可用、高并发、高性能及分布式、Jvm性能调优、Spring源码,MyBatis,
风平浪静如码
·
2023-12-16 08:49
面试必问系列,源码解析多线程绝对不容忽视得问题:线程活性故障
我们是不是忘记了某一个很重要得知识点——线程活性故障线程活性故障是由于资源稀缺性或者程序自身的问题导致线程一直处于非Runnable状态,或者线程虽然处于Runnable状态但是其要执行的任务一直无法取得进展的一种故障现象关注公众号:
Java
java架构师联盟
·
2023-12-16 06:31
2020-03-09 7种
设计原则
单一原则接口隔离原则依赖倒转原则接口!抽象类!抽象和细节1.接口2.构造函数3.setter里氏替换原则编程中如何正确使用继承避免重写通过base类,依赖,聚合,组合开闭原则编程中最基础和最重要的拓展开放(对于提供方),修改关闭(对于使用方)迪米特法则(最少知道法则)直接朋友,类中成员变量,方法参数,方法返回值非直接朋友:局部变量中出现的类---陌生的类降低耦合合成复用原则尽量使用合成、聚合的(h
很菜的花椰菜
·
2023-12-16 00:58
Java工程师通宵都要看完这几本阿里P8都强烈推荐的Java电子书
以下是楼主收藏的电子书籍以及
java架构
学习资料添加图片注释,不超过140字(可选)面试资料添加图片注释,不超过140字(可选)Java核心知识文档添加图片注释,不超过140字(可选)Java核心知识PDF1
写代码的珏秒秒
·
2023-12-15 23:53
java
开发语言
设计模式(三)-结构型模式(2)-桥接模式
根据
设计原则
中的单一职责原则:各自模块应当保持各自的分工任务。比如在画图系统中存在形状和画笔的两个维度。形状负责的是它的模样(矩形、圆形、三角形等),而画笔负责的是铅笔、毛笔、圆
CRongQ
·
2023-12-15 21:43
设计模式
设计模式
桥接模式
java
构建高效预约系统:预约系统源码的设计与实现
在本文中,我们将深入研究预约系统的
设计原则
,并提供一些关键的技术代码示例,帮助读者更好地理解如何实现一个稳定、安全且高性能的预约系统。
万岳科技
·
2023-12-15 21:49
数据库
科技
学习
500 lines or less学习笔记(九)——内存中的图数据库(Dagoba)
本文利用JavaScript实现了一个内存中的图数据库,用来解决一些现实中的问题,本文不仅介绍了整体的设计思路和
设计原则
,还详细介绍了图数据库实现的一些细节,很多地方值得学习.作者介绍Dann喜欢和他两岁的孩子建造东西
简单一点点
·
2023-12-15 14:40
详解Apache Dubbo的SPI实现机制
在Java中,SPI体现了面向接口编程的思想,满足开闭
设计原则
。1.1JDK自带SPI实现从JDK1.6开始引入SPI机制后,可以看到很多使用SPI的案例,比如最常见的
vivo互联网技术
·
2023-12-15 12:47
【华为数据之道学习笔记】3-11元数据管理
(2)针对找数据及获取数据难的痛点,明确业务元数据、技术元数据、操作元数据的
设计原则
。
码农丁丁
·
2023-12-15 11:04
#
数据中台
华为数据之道
数据中台
读书笔记
06-微服务架构之微服务设计指导书
文章目录前言一、微服务常规的
设计原则
二、微服务的设计步骤1、确定服务边界,划分领域模型2、设计数据模型3、定义服务接口,确定通信机制4、服务的可用性和可伸缩性5、其他需要考虑的因素总结前言经过前面的学习
月空MoonSky
·
2023-12-15 10:05
#
微服务
架构
微服务
运维
云原生
java
如何成为
java架构
师(一)
记得,2005年,那是个冷东,小白和小新坐上火车去北京了。第一次来北京,很是惊喜,惊奇。快到北京的时候,火车上有人说,到北京了,快到站了。小白和小新立即向火车窗外望去,哎呀,这就是北京啊,没看到与其它城市有什么区别。下了火车,小白和小新找住处,联系之前的老同学,一时间联系不上。夜黑,天冷,饥饿,此时两人有点慌,怎么办呢?等了好久,才联系上小白的同学,然后安排住在学校的地下室宾馆,然后吃方便面,每天
sao.hk
·
2023-12-15 09:45
感想
程序人生
以前我无力应对失眠,直到看到软件
设计原则
其中
设计原则
又是架构设计的指导思想,更精炼更抽象。和它相比,设计模式、数据结构、算法都还算具体了。当然,这类书也还是很好睡,我看这些都犯困。
twowinter_
·
2023-12-15 05:48
聊聊设计模式——原型模式
目录1.原型模式定义2.优点3.缺点4.原型模式结构说明5.工作流程6.示例7.应用场景8.本质9.涉及的
设计原则
10.与其他设计模式的关系11.开源框架中的应用:原型模式定义:用原型实例指定创建对象的种类
Elaine202391
·
2023-12-15 04:57
设计模式
设计模式
原型模式
java
第七章-交互
设计原则
交互
设计原则
是关于行为,形式与内容的普遍适用法则,促使产品行为支持用户目标与需求,创建积极的用户体验,科技的使用体验应当根据人类的感知,认知与运动能力来创造。
_达斯基
·
2023-12-15 04:28
设计模式01
设计模式-概述参考网课:黑马程序员Java设计模式详解[博客笔记](https://zgtsky.top/)课程内容整个课程分为3大部分:第一部分是设计模式相关介绍设计模式的概述UML图软件
设计原则
第二部分是设计模式的学习创建者模式
JAT9321
·
2023-12-15 03:11
设计模式
Java
设计模式
java
后端
(c++笔记)第三十三节课:设计模式(部分)
目录一设计模式##1.1
设计原则
例1:例2:二单例模式2.1懒汉式##2.2饿汉式三工厂模式##3.1抽象工厂模式四建造者模式4.1简单版4.2建造者模式五原型模式六组合模式七代理模式八装饰模式九适配器模式
xaf21
·
2023-12-15 03:39
c++
笔记
c++
设计模式
开发语言
基于ssm的宠物领养系统论文
目录摘要IABSTRACTII1引言11.1课题背景11.2
设计原则
11.3论文组织结构12系统关键技术32.1JSP技术32.2JAVA技术32.3B/S结构32.4MYSQL数据库43系统分析53.1
qq1744828575
·
2023-12-15 02:23
java
java
《C++新经典设计模式》之第22章 总结
《C++新经典设计模式》之第22章总结面向对象程序
设计原则
开放封闭原则:扩展开放,修改封闭,增加新功能时,已有代码不变,增加新类、新成员函数实现。
mali378287007
·
2023-12-14 22:03
c++
设计模式
面向对象的七个
设计原则
一、单一职责原则一个类,最好只做一件事,只有一个引起它的变化。单一职责原则可以看做是低耦合、高内聚在面向对象原则上的引申,将职责定义为引起变化的原因,以提高内聚性来减少引起变化的原因。职责过多,可能引起它变化的原因就越多,这将导致职责依赖,相互之间就产生影响,从而大大损伤其内聚性和耦合度。通常意义下的单一职责,就是指只有一种单一功能,不要为类实现过多的功能点,以保证实体只有一个引起它变化的原因。专
omygodvv
·
2023-12-14 22:33
软件工程
设计模式:我所理解的七大
设计原则
设计模式,其实只是前人针对某类问题的代码设计经验而已
设计原则
(图片来自互联网,侵删)设计模式应遵循的原则:单一职责原则:一个类只有一个引起他变化的原因,相关性很高的函数、数据封装到一个类中。
Marker_Sky
·
2023-12-14 16:06
Java架构
师系统架构实现高内聚低耦合
目录1导语2边界内聚耦合概述3聚焦内聚4关注耦合5如何实现高内聚低耦合6内聚耦合规划不当的效果7总结想学习架构师构建流程请跳转:
Java架构
师系统架构设计1导语架构设计的核心维度,从系统的扩展性、高性能
赵广陆
·
2023-12-14 16:52
architect
java
系统架构
开发语言
Java架构
师系统架构提升扩展性
目录1导语2架构扩展性-应用扩展3架构扩展性-数据扩展4组织可扩展性5流程可扩展性6多快好省-扩展性实现方案7单体应用从数百节点到数万节点的扩展历程8总结想学习架构师构建流程请跳转:
Java架构
师系统架构设计
赵广陆
·
2023-12-14 16:52
architect
java
系统架构
开发语言
Java架构
师系统架构
设计原则
应用
目录1导语2如何设计高并发系统:局部并发原则3如何设计高并发系统:服务化与拆分4高可用系统有哪些
设计原则
?
赵广陆
·
2023-12-14 16:22
architect
java
系统架构
开发语言
Java架构
师系统架构设计服务拆分应用
可用性的保障手段-流量整形8设计网关层限流和分布式限流9EDA事件驱动简述10EDA事件驱动构建的实时账务系统11微服务的数据一致性-BASE理论12计微服务的数据一致性幂等性理论想学习架构师构建流程请跳转:
Java
赵广陆
·
2023-12-14 16:12
architect
java
系统架构
开发语言
软件
设计原则
:耦合与内聚
目录什么是耦合?耦合的定义类型和影响什么是内聚?内聚的定义类型和优点耦合与内聚的平衡结语在软件开发中,良好的设计是构建可维护、可扩展和可理解的系统的关键。耦合和内聚是软件设计中两个至关重要的概念,它们直接影响着代码质量和系统的可维护性。本文将深入探讨耦合和内聚的含义,以及如何在软件设计中达到良好的平衡。什么是耦合?耦合的定义耦合是指两个模块之间的依赖关系。当一个模块的修改影响到另一个模块时,我们称
人不走空
·
2023-12-14 15:28
软件工程
全球6G发展大会开幕,为什么我们需要6G
6G发展大会由中国IMT-2030(6G)推进组、中国通信学会、重庆两江新区管理委员会联合主办的2023全球6G发展大会今天在重庆两江新区明月湖成功开幕,开幕式上发布了《6G网络架构展望》《6G无线系统
设计原则
和典型特征
柒号华仔
·
2023-12-06 22:09
5G
6G
5G
信息与通信
Spring第四课,MVC终章,应用分层的好处,总结
SpringMVC其实也就是SpringWeb软件的
设计原则
:高内聚,低耦合高内聚:一个模块各个元素之间联系的紧密程度,如果各个元素(语句,程序段)之间的联系程度越高,即内聚性越高低耦合:软件中各个层,
狗哥不是甜妹
·
2023-12-06 21:13
spring
mvc
java
设计模式——七大
设计原则
设计模式——七大
设计原则
1、单一职责原则(SRP)2、开放封闭原则(OCP)3、依赖倒转原则(DIP)4、里氏替换原则(LSP)5、接口隔离原则(ISP)6、合成/聚合复用原则(CARP)7、迪米特法则
酷酷的懒虫
·
2023-12-06 19:37
设计模式
设计模式
DCGAN生成网络模型
以下是DCGAN的一些关键特征和
设计原则
:去全连接层:DCGAN中的生成器和判别器网络中通常不包含全连接层,而是使用卷积层和反卷积层。BatchNormal
普通研究者
·
2023-12-06 18:02
深度学习论文阅读记录
深度学习案例实战
图像处理
网络
Android实验:绑定service实验
目录实验目的实验内容实验要求项目结构代码实现代码解释结果展示实验目的充分理解Service的作用,与Activity之间的区别,掌握Service的生命周期以及对应函数,了解Service的主线程性质;掌握主线程的界面刷新的
设计原则
此镬加之于你
·
2023-12-06 13:05
移动设备软件开发
android
android
studio
xml
阿里P8架构师精讲开源+高性能+高并发+分布式+微服务+实战等
1.架构巩基2.开源框架3.高性能架构4.微服务架构5.团队协作开发6.B2C项目实战精讲架构视频资料获取方式工作一到五年的java开发工程师朋友可以加入我们
Java架构
交流群:760940986群内提供高可用
java成功之路
·
2023-12-06 13:58
2021最全的
Java架构
面试指南:java动态代理面试题
前言众所皆知的,Linux的核心原型是1991年由托瓦兹(LinusTorvalds)写出来的,但是托瓦兹为何可以写出Linux这个操作系统?为什么它要选择386的计算机来开发?为什么Linux的发展可以这么迅速?又为什么Linux是免费的?以及目前为何有这么多的Linux版本(distributions)呢?了解这些东西后,才能够知道为何Linux可以免除专利软件之争,并且了解到Linux为何可
JVM虚拟机资料
·
2023-12-06 10:17
程序员
java
后端
面试
【C++高并发编程】reactor并发编程模型
文章目录提纲引言Reactor模式概述Reactor模式定义和
设计原则
Reactor模式与其他并发模式的比较Reactor模式适用的场景和优势Reactor模式组件Reactor事件源事件处理器具体业务逻辑事件和事件类型模式工作原理
ichdream
·
2023-12-06 08:11
C++高性能编程
高性能计算
服务器
linux
c++
架构
车载系统
『测试基础』| 如何理解测试用例管理和缺陷管理?
1测试用例定义2测试用例
设计原则
3测试用例的评审4测试如何维护?
虫无涯
·
2023-12-05 17:58
#
软件测试基础
测试用例
缺陷管理
测试管理
组织架构设计的关键5要素
但遵循合理的
设计原则
及标准,可让我们完成引以为傲的目标。临近年底,你经过了诊断与判断,拟要调整或设计组织架构。在设计时,请记得要满足一以下五个要素。①第一个要素-职能结构。财务部门算不算一个职能?
晏子出刀
·
2023-12-05 14:24
《通用设计法则》读书笔记
今天翻阅《通用
设计原则
》这本书讲色彩的部分,把他从设计角度讲颜色特性和颜色应用的观点完整地摘抄下来。1、关于颜色:设计上用颜色来吸引注意,集合元素,表明含义,以及增加美感。
小晨形象设计
·
2023-12-05 13:12
flask web开发学习之初识flask(三)
这些扩展通常遵循Flask的
设计原则
,易于集成到flask应用中,并且可以大大加快开发速度。常用flask扩展:Flask-SQLAlchemy:操作SQLAlc
此处不留情
·
2023-12-05 12:01
flask学习
flask
前端
学习
大数据Hadoop集群的启动
1.6hadoop-daemon.sh的使用2HDFS常用的操作命令3hdfs的高级使用命令3.1HDFS文件限额配置3.2数量限额3.3空间大小限额3.4HDFS的管理命令3.5hdfs的安全模式想学习架构师构建流程请跳转:
Java
赵广陆
·
2023-12-05 08:13
hadoop
hadoop
big
data
hdfs
设计模式之代理模式(1)
目录概述定义应用场景主要角色类图详述基本代码应用实例符合的
设计原则
总结概述定义 代理模式是一种结构型设计模式,它允许通过一个代理对象来控制对原始对象的访问。
赛男丨木子丿小喵
·
2023-12-05 06:32
设计模式
设计模式
代理模式
UniRepLKNet:用于音频、视频、点云、时间序列和图像识别的通用感知大内核ConvNet
(1)现有大核ConvNets的架构在很大程度上遵循传统ConvNets或变压器的
设计原则
,而大核ConvNets的架构设计仍未得到充分解决。
静静AI学堂
·
2023-12-05 05:37
高质量AI论文翻译
音视频
java中简单的策略模式的实现
1)开闭原则(OpenClosedPrinciple)是编程中最基础、最重要的
设计原则
2)一个软件实体如类,模块和函数应该对扩展开放(对提供方),对修改关闭(对使用方)。
linab112
·
2023-12-05 05:00
java常用
java
大数据开发:Hive on Spark
设计原则
及架构
今天的大数据开发分享,我们来讲讲HiveonSpark
设计原则
及架构。
成都加米谷大数据
·
2023-12-05 01:44
JS设计模式——设计模式概论
文章目录前言一、设计模式1.设计模式扮演的角色2.程序
设计原则
3.设计模式的分类总结前言在了解设计模式后,发现它起始没有那么高大上,有些是我们平时开发中已经用到的东西(更好的设计模块,组织共同的代码),
梦回小岛
·
2023-12-05 00:40
前端进阶笔记
#
Javascript进阶
javascript
设计模式
开发语言
盘点JavaScript设计模式(常用十五大设计模式)
javaScript设计模式前言一、
设计原则
单一职责原则(SRP)最少知识原则(LKP)开放-封闭原则(OCP)里氏替换原则TheLiskovSubstitutionPrinciple(LSP)接口分离原则
清风木子云
·
2023-12-05 00:06
JavaScript
前端
javascript
设计模式
六大
设计原则
-最少知识原则
最少知识原则LeastKnowledgePrinciple简称LKP什么是最少知识原则一个软件实体应当尽可能少地与其他实体发生相互作用。减少对象(方法、系统、类、模块等)之间的联系。最少知识原则的优点降低类之间的耦合。由于每个类尽量减少对其他类的依赖,因此,很容易使得系统的功能模块功能独立,相互之间不存在(或很少有)依赖关系。如何做到最少知识原则只与直接的朋友通信每个对象都必然会与其他对象有耦合关
小杰66
·
2023-12-05 00:49
2020-02-06
景区规划
设计原则
1.个性化原则个性化塑造的旅游项目的不可取代行,不可取代性才成了景区发展的核心竞争力。个性化设计是建立在对地方文化和本土文化充分了解的基础上,才做出地方味十足的特色产品设计。
sky_b1b0
·
2023-12-04 23:53
设计模式系列(二) ——策略模式
策略模式策略模式概要策略模式定义策略模式结构鸭子模型引入提出需求解决方案之——使用继承解决方案之——使用接口解决方案之——策略模式总结策略模式涉及的
设计原则
策略模式优缺点策略模式概要策略模式定义什么是策略模式
羽凌薇
·
2023-12-04 21:12
设计模式
java
设计模式
Spring 注入方式
Spring框架中最核心的技术就是:IOC(控制反转):是面向对象编程中的一种
设计原则
,可以用来减低计算机代码之间的耦合度(百度百科)。
Java陈序员
·
2023-12-04 17:20
spring
java
上一页
11
12
13
14
15
16
17
18
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他